MANILA – Singer-actress Rachel Alejandro stars in the Philippine production of the Tony Award-winning musical “Monty Python’s Spamalot.”
“Spamalot” tells a crazy version of the story of King Arthur, the Knights of the Round Table and their quest for the holy grail. It is based on the film “Monty Python and the Holy Grail,” which is considered one of the funniest comedies of all time.
